I am currently reading Six Days of War: June 1967 and the Making of the Modern Middle East by Michael B. Oren. I have to say, Pakistan's situation vis a vis India reminds me a lot of Israel's with Egypt and the Arab world c. 1967. Both are dwarfed by their enemies, both feel any war may well be a war for survival, and thus both are in a situation where enough pressure could provoke them to strike first to knock out their enemy. I fear Modhi, with election-year myopia and public opinion whipped to a fevered pitch (first by the suicide bombing, then by the capture of this pilot), might push Pakistan over the edge.
